I was looking for a Tron for over a year and a half and couldn't find a super nice one for under $800. Tron's have been worth more than $500 since before the movie was even announced.

This.

You can find a crappy looking, worn out, or project Tron for under $500 (someone just picked one up for $100), but if you want a nice one that works perfectly and isn't going to break down in the next two months, then you'll most likely spend what it's worth to us collectors - about $800. To a non-collector, that probably jumps to $1200, and with the movie coming out, all bets are off.

It doesn't surprise me in the slightest that Chris sold his for $2200. I'd do the same. What surprises me is that he told any of y'all about it. Most of y'all don't understand non-collector or retail selling, and think any game you can buy half-broken and fix up yourself must only be worth $150...
